a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orTed Gould <ted@gould.cx>2010-07-16 15:10:58 -0500
committerTed Gould <ted@gould.cx>2010-07-16 15:10:58 -0500
commitbf3973945daef188061f2b6a4486206baaacc49d (patch)
tree481519de2ed6114b5f0da75a2f6587d71a661c39
parent81b745b7309fa958e96e3df8d683b77cf2f2dac4 (diff)
downloadayatana-indicator-datetime-bf3973945daef188061f2b6a4486206baaacc49d.tar.gz
ayatana-indicator-datetime-bf3973945daef188061f2b6a4486206baaacc49d.tar.bz2
ayatana-indicator-datetime-bf3973945daef188061f2b6a4486206baaacc49d.zip
Ah, dumb bug
-rw-r--r--src/indicator-datetime.c3
1 files changed, 2 insertions, 1 deletions
diff --git a/src/indicator-datetime.c b/src/indicator-datetime.c
index b68a6ea..5d7502f 100644
--- a/src/indicator-datetime.c
+++ b/src/indicator-datetime.c
@@ -631,8 +631,9 @@ static gint
generate_strftime_bitmask (IndicatorDatetime * self)
{
gint retval = 0;
- glong strlength = g_utf8_strlen(self->priv->time_string, 0);
+ glong strlength = g_utf8_strlen(self->priv->time_string, -1);
gint i;
+ g_debug("Evaluating bitmask for '%s'", self->priv->time_string);
for (i = 0; i < strlength; i++) {
if (self->priv->time_string[i] == '%' && i + 1 < strlength) {